Crown Resorts At Lake Tansi East - Crossville
35.87849, -85.05943Crown Resorts At Lake Tansi East Crossville, situated around 10 minutes' drive from Stillhouse Creek Lake, offers an indoor swimming pool as well as a fitness studio. This Crossville hotel, situated just a short drive from Fall Creek Falls, offers a hot tub and a sauna.
Location
Lake Tansi is within walking distance of the beachfront Crown Resorts At Lake Tansi East, and McGhee Tyson airport is 78 miles away. Take benefit from the proximity to Tansi Beach, which is about 1 mile away.
Rooms
The family Crown Resorts At Lake Tansi East Crossville has 34 rooms, comprising an adjoining terrace and a sitting area. Complimentary wireless internet and a flat-screen TV with satellite channels, along with coffee and tea making equipment, are offered. Furnished with a couch, they also have a stone fireplace. Offering a bathtub, a separate toilet, and a shower, the bathrooms are also appointed with a hair dryer and towels.
Eat & Drink
Guests can enjoy the snack bar on premises.
Leisure & Business
Guests can also benefit from a golf course, along with a full-service spa and a spa salon provided at the hotel.
